Independent Contractor Agreement Letter
An Independent Contractor Agreement Letter is a legally binding document that defines the specific working relationship between a client and a self-employed professional. It is essential for establishing clear expectations regarding project scope, payment terms, and deadlines. Key provisions should protect intellectual property rights and include confidentiality clauses to secure sensitive data. This agreement serves as vital evidence for tax authorities to prove that the worker is not an employee, thereby limiting liability and ensuring legal compliance for both parties throughout the duration of the professional engagement.

Confidentiality And Non-Disclosure Letter
A Confidentiality and Non-Disclosure Letter is a legally binding contract used to protect sensitive information shared between parties. It prevents the unauthorized disclosure of trade secrets, financial data, or proprietary intellectual property. By signing this document, the recipient agrees to maintain strict confidentiality and use the information only for specified purposes. This letter is essential during business negotiations or employment to mitigate legal risks and safeguard competitive advantages. Ensuring clear definitions of protected data and the duration of the agreement is vital for effective legal enforcement.

Compliance And Background Check Letter
A Compliance and Background Check Letter serves as a formal notification that an individual is undergoing verification of their criminal, professional, and financial history. This essential document ensures transparency between employers and candidates while maintaining adherence to FCRA regulations and data privacy laws. It outlines the scope of the screening process, seeking informed consent to validate credentials. Organizations utilize these letters to mitigate risk, uphold safety standards, and ensure legal regulatory compliance during the hiring or auditing phase, making it a critical component of professional due diligence and corporate security protocols.

What documents are required for freelancer registration?
You must provide a signed W-9 (for US-based) or W-8BEN (for international) form, valid government-issued identification, a copy of your professional liability insurance if applicable, and direct deposit details for payment processing.
